Beschreibung:
The Italian Yearbook of Human Rights 2017 offers an up-to-date overview of the measures Italy has taken to adapt its legislation and policies to international human rights law and to comply with commitments voluntarily assumed by the Italian Government at the international level on the subject of fundamental rights. The 2017 Yearbook surveys the most significant activities of national and local Italian actors at domestic and international level, including civil society organisations and universities. It also dedicates space to recommendations made by international monitoring bodies within the framework of the United Nations, OSCE, the Council of Europe, and the European Union. Finally, the Yearbook provides a selection of international and national case-law that casts light on Italy's position vis-à-vis internationally recognised human rights.
Content: Italy and Human Rights - Universal Ethics, Good Governance - Italian Agenda of Human Rights 2017 - International Human Rights Law - Italian Law - National Bodies with Jurisdiction over Human Rights - Sub-national Human Rights Structures - Council of Europe - European Union -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e - Humanitarian and Criminal Law - Human Rights in Italian Case-law - Italy in the Case-law of the European Court of Human Rights - Italy in the Case-law of the Court of Justice of the European Union.
